USING THE ELECTRONIC METER
POWER ON :
POWER OFF :
MODE / CLEAR BUTTON:
Walking Belt movement or push the button. Automatic shut off after 4 minutes of ina ctivity .
Press and rele ase to select functions. Press and hold f or three seconds to reset all functions to zero.
FUNCTIONS:
SCAN:
TIME:
SPEED:
Automatically scans TIME, SPEED, DISTANCE, and CALORIES in sequence with a change every four seconds. Press a nd release the button until " to SCAN.
Displays the time from 1 sec. up to 99:59 minutes. Displays the current speed from zero to 999.9 Mile/Hr .
" a ppears on the display and points
DISTANCE:
CALORIES:
Displays the distance from zero to 99.99 miles. Displays the calorie consumption, from zero to 999.9 Kcal.
The calorie readout is a n estimate f or an average user . It should be used only a s a comparison between workouts on this unit.

TREADMILL ADJUSTMENTS
The ba sic idea behind the ma nual treadmill is to have the belt running on a tre admill board a nd between two rollers so that the belt will move without much effort. In order for the belt to run smoothly, there are a few points that need to be noted.
BELT ALIGNMENT
The belt must be in the center of the treadmill to prevent it from rubbing against the flywheels. If the belt rubs a flywheel, it will be difficult to keep the belt moving and eventually damage the edge of the belt.
The treadmill has belt guides welded to the bottom of the treadmill frame that move the belt toward the center of the treadmill. However, the rear roller must be properly aligned with the treadmill frame and front roller if the belt is to remain centered on the treadmill.
The bolts in the rear of the treadmill (one on the left and the other on the right) adjust the alignment of the rear roller as well as the tension of the belt.
The belt will run to the side of the loose rear bolt. Hint:
Eyeball the rear roller to make sure both the right side and the left side of the roller are the same distance from the back edge of the treadmill. Use the 4mm ALLEN WRENCH to make these adjustments. Turn the bolts Clockwise to tighten and Counter-Clockwise to loosen.
BEL T D RIFTING LEFT
Turn the left screw 1/4 turn CLOCKWISE and the right screw 1/4 turn COUNTER-CLOCKWISE, then walk on the treadmill. Repeat if needed.
BEL T DRIFTING RIGHT
Turn the left screw 1/4 turn COUNTER-CLOCKWISE and the right screw 1/4 turn CLOCKWISE, then walk on the treadmill. Repeat if needed.
LEFT
ADJUSTMENT
RIGHT
ADJUSTMENT
NOTE:
When you believe the WALKING BELT is centered, use the treadmill for three (3) minutes to verify the WALKING BELT won't drift to one side. If the WALKING BEL T continue s to drift, the floor may not be level.
Rotate the treadmill 90 degrees or move the tre admill to another location.
BELT TENSION
The belt should be tight and not lying on the tre admill board. If the belt is too loose, the belt will slip on the front roller and you will notice a jerky movement when you wal k on the treadmill. If the belt is too tight, the edges of the belt will begin to curl and more ef fort will be required to move the belt. Excessive belt tension can also damage the bearings in the rollers. The bolts in the rear of the treadmill (one on the left and the other on the right) adjust the tension of the belt as well as the alignment of the rear roller.
BELT TOO LOOSE: Use the 4mm ALLEN WRENCH to tighten the bolts in the rear of the treadmill.
Tighten both rollers 1/4 turn at a time until the belt stops slipping on the front roller.
BEL T TOO TIGHT: Use the 4mm ALLEN WRENCH to loosen the bolts in the rear of the trea dmill. Loosen
both rollers 1/2 turn at a time until the belt begins to sli p on the front roller . Then use the procedure a bove to tighten the belt.

TREADMILL ADJUSTMENTS WALKING RESISTANCE
The walking resistance or effort needed to push the treadmill belt can be adjusted by changing the incline angle. This treadmill has two adjustment positions.
Highest Re sistance
The BUMPER STANDS(20) are attached to
the bottom of the treadmill.
Remove (unscrew) the BUMPER STANDS(20) from the bottom of the treadmill and store them
Lowest Re si stance
in the end of the treadmill.
NOTE:
Since this is a new machine, you may need some time to get used to walking on the treadmill and to
1.
break it in. If the walking resista nce is still too high, check the BELT TENSION.
2.
The belt resistance can be reduced by adding silicone lubricant between the belt and the board. Wipe
3.
the board under the belt with a cloth and spray or spread silicone lubricant on the board under the belt.
